@charset "utf-8";
/* CSS Document */
/*==== Homepage stylesheet ====*/
.sys_HomepageBanner {
	margin-bottom: 10px;
	height: 208px;
}
.sys_HomePageContentArea .sys_YourOpinionBox {
	background: transparent url("/SiteElements/images/bkgrnd-whats-your-opininion.gif") 0 0 no-repeat;
	margin-bottom: 0;
}
/*====@@ Homepage Three Column Layout for the Feature Boxes ====*/
.sys_ThreeColumnFeaturesLayout {
	float: left;
}
.sys_HomeFeaturesRow1 {margin-bottom: 10px;}
.sys_HomeFeaturesRow2 {}
.sys_width155 {
	width: 155px;
	margin-right: 8px;
}
.sys_width236 {
	width: 236px;
}
.sys_ThreeColumnFeaturesLayout h2 {
	padding: 4px 0 4px 38px;
	margin: 0 0 1px 0;
	color: #4c4c4c;
	overflow: hidden;
	font-size: 1em
}
.sys_ThreeColumnFeaturesLayout h2 span {font-weight: 400;}
.sys_ThreeColumnFeaturesLayout .sys_HomeFeaturesRow1 .sys_ColumnOne h2 {background: transparent url("/SiteElements/images/bkgrnd-home-featureHeaderRow1Col1.png") 0 0 no-repeat;}
.sys_ThreeColumnFeaturesLayout .sys_HomeFeaturesRow1 .sys_ColumnTwo h2 {background: transparent url("/SiteElements/images/bkgrnd-home-featureHeaderRow1Col2.png") 0 0 no-repeat;}
.sys_ThreeColumnFeaturesLayout .sys_HomeFeaturesRow1 .sys_ColumnThree h2 {background: transparent url("/SiteElements/images/bkgrnd-home-featureHeaderRow1Col3.png") 0 0 no-repeat;}
.sys_ThreeColumnFeaturesLayout .sys_HomeFeaturesRow2 .sys_ColumnOne h2 {background: transparent url("/SiteElements/images/bkgrnd-home-featureHeaderRow2Col1.png") 0 0 no-repeat;}
.sys_ThreeColumnFeaturesLayout .sys_HomeFeaturesRow2 .sys_ColumnTwo h2 {background: transparent url("/SiteElements/images/bkgrnd-home-featureHeaderRow2Col2.png") 0 0 no-repeat;}
.sys_ThreeColumnFeaturesLayout .sys_HomeFeaturesRow2 .sys_ColumnThree h2 {background: transparent url("/SiteElements/images/bkgrnd-home-featureHeaderRow2Col3.png") 0 0 no-repeat;}
.sys_ThreeColumnFeaturesLayout .sys_HomeFeaturesRow1 .sys_ColumnThree .sys_HomepageFeatureBoxContent,
.sys_ThreeColumnFeaturesLayout .sys_HomeFeaturesRow2 .sys_ColumnThree .sys_HomepageFeatureBoxContent {/* background: #f2f2f2; */ min-height: 68px;}
/*====@@ End of Homepage Three Column Layout for the Feature Boxes ====*/
.sys_column.sys_width155.sys_ColumnOne .sys_HomepageFeatureBoxContent,
.sys_column.sys_width155.sys_ColumnTwo .sys_HomepageFeatureBoxContent {position: relative; min-height: 71px;}
.sys_column.sys_width155.sys_ColumnOne .sys_HomepageFeatureBoxContent a span,
.sys_column.sys_width155.sys_ColumnTwo  .sys_HomepageFeatureBoxContent a span {display: none;}
.sys_column.sys_width155.sys_ColumnOne .sys_HomepageFeatureBoxContent a:hover span,
.sys_column.sys_width155.sys_ColumnTwo .sys_HomepageFeatureBoxContent a:hover span {
	display: block; 
	position: absolute; 
	bottom: 3px; 
	right: 3px;
}
.sys_HomepageFeatureBox .sys_HomepageFeatureBoxContent .sys_HomeMoreLink {
	font-size: 0.8em; 
	margin: 0; 
	padding: 0; 
	line-height: 0.8em;
	position: absolute;
	bottom: 4px;
	right: 10px;
}
.sys_HomepageFeatureBox .sys_HomepageFeatureBoxContent .sys_HomeMoreLink a {color: #4c4c4c}

/* GCH News mini listing styles */
.sys_news-control #GCHNewsListing_List ul {margin: 0; padding: 0;}
.sys_news-control #GCHNewsListing_List ul li {list-style: none;}
.sys_news-control #GCHNewsListing_List ul li {list-style: none;}
.sys_news-control #GCHNewsListing_List dl {margin: 0;}
.sys_news-control #GCHNewsListing_List dt.sys_news-description {display: none;}
.sys_news-control #GCHNewsListing_List dd.sys_news-description {margin: 0; font-size: 0.8em;}
.sys_news-control #GCHNewsListing_List .sys_thumbnail {float: left; margin-right: 10px;}
.sys_news-control #GCHNewsListing_List .sys_subitem {border: 0;}
.sys_news-control #GCHNewsListing_List h3 {margin-left: 0; font-size: 0.9em !important; }
.sys_news-control #GCHNewsListing_List h3 a {color: #4C4C4C; text-decoration: none;}
.sys_news-control #GCHNewsListing_List h3 a:hover {text-decoration: underline;}
.sys_itemslist {padding: 0 0 0 6px;}
#GCHNewsListing_List .sys_MiniListing {padding: 0 !important;}
.sys_theme-simple .sys_datarepeatercontrol .sys_subitem {margin: 10px 0 0 !important; padding: 0 !important }
#GCHNewsListing_List.sys_datarepeatercontrol {background: #f2f2f2; height: 76px;}

/* GCH Events Mini Listing */
.sys_events-control #GCHEventsListing_List ul {margin: 0; padding: 0;}
.sys_events-control #GCHEventsListing_List ul li {list-style: none;}
.sys_events-control #GCHEventsListing_List ul li {list-style: none;}
.sys_events-control #GCHEventsListing_List dt.sys_events-time {display: none;}
.sys_events-control #GCHEventsListing_List dd.sys_events-time {margin: 0; font-size: 0.8em;}
.sys_events-control #GCHEventsListing_List dt.sys_events-location  {display: none;}
.sys_events-control #GCHEventsListing_List dd.sys_events-location {margin: 0; font-size: 0.8em;}
.sys_events-control #GCHEventsListing_List .sys_thumbnail {float: left;}
.sys_events-control #GCHEventsListing_List .sys_subitem {border: 0;}
.sys_events-control #GCHEventsListing_List h3 {margin-left: 0; font-size: 0.9em !important;}
.sys_events-control #GCHEventsListing_List h3 a {color: #4C4C4C; text-decoration: none}
.sys_events-control #GCHEventsListing_List h3 a:hover {text-decoration: underline}
#GCHEventsListing_List .sys_itemslist dl {margin: 0; padding: 0;}
#GCHEventsListing_List.sys_datarepeatercontrol {background: #f2f2f2; height: 76px;}

.sys_MiniListing {position: relative;}
.sys_MoreLink {position: absolute; bottom: 0; right: 0; padding: 0 8px 4px 0; font-size: 0.8em;}
.sys_MoreLink a {color: #000; text-decoration: none}
.sys_MoreLink a:hover {text-decoration: underline}

